Summary
The weather is getting cold in Cuba, but fear not Canadians, CBC might send you on a lovely warm tropical getaway to a communist dictatorship. Yes, Cuba is the choice of CBC s latest contest, the Holiday Escape to Cuba contest, which is sponsored not only by Sunwing Vacations and the Cuban Government, but also by the Cuban government.
